Ena's Secret Bake Introduce
Introduction / Overview
For Florida residents seeking a truly authentic taste of Latin American and particularly Cuban dessert tradition, Ena's Secret Bake in Tampa is an essential stop. This Latino-owned bakery stands out as a colorful and inviting destination, offering a delicious array of pastries, cakes, and light savory items that celebrate a rich culinary heritage. Located in the heart of Tampa, Ena's Secret Bake is more than just a place to satisfy a sweet craving; it’s a cultural experience.
The bakery’s specialty lies in its magnificent cakes and traditional Cuban sweets, often crafted with an eye-catching visual appeal. The menu showcases deep-rooted, authentic flavors that are designed to evoke nostalgia and deliver a memorable indulgence. Patrons frequently visit for a quick taste of home or to pick up an impressive centerpiece for a special occasion. While the selection of desserts, such as the famous Brazo Gitano (Gypsy's Arm roll cake) and various full-sized cakes, draws immediate attention, the menu also features Cuban-inspired savory fare, making it a comprehensive spot for a morning treat or an afternoon pick-me-up.
The atmosphere of Ena's Secret Bake is noted for being particularly vibrant and clean, often described by customers as being very “pink” and pretty, contributing to a cheerful and visually engaging environment that enhances the experience of enjoying their unique offerings. The dedication to authentic flavors and the creation of beautiful, high-quality products are the core of this local Tampa bakery’s identity.

Services Offered
Ena's Secret Bake focuses on providing efficient and flexible services to meet the needs of the Tampa community.
- Takeout: Customers can easily place an order and take their selection of fresh cakes, pastries, and savory items to go.
- Delivery: For ultimate convenience, the bakery offers delivery services, allowing locals to enjoy their authentic Cuban sweets and other menu items at home or at the office.
- Savory Menu Items: Beyond the sweet focus, the bakery provides hot food and breakfast items, such as Tostadas C/ Huevo Revuelto (Toast with Scrambled Eggs), Tortilla, and the highly praised Pan con Lechon (pork sandwich), which one review highlighted for being "soo good a lot of meat."
- Custom Cake Orders: The bakery specializes in full-sized cakes for various celebrations, with flavor options including Dulce De Leche Cake, Guayaba Cake, Nutella Cake, and a variety of Nata (custard) cakes.
- Beverage Service: A full array of drinks is available, featuring traditional Cuban coffee drinks like Café C Leche (Coffee with Milk), Cortadito, and Colada, along with popular sodas and fruit smoothies like Batidos De Mamey.
